  • Wind Erosion and Deposition | Earth Science Lumen Learning

    Wind can carry small particles such as sand, silt, and clay Wind erosion abrades surfaces and makes desert pavement, ventifacts, and desert varnish Sand dunes are common wind deposits that come in different shapes, depending on winds and sand availability Loess is a very fine grained, windborne deposit that can be important to soil formation
